Thomas Ruscher

Thomas Ruscher (1449–1510) was a Roman Catholic prelate who served as Auxiliary Bishop of Mainz (1502–1510).

[1][2][3] On 19 Mar 1503, he was consecrated bishop by Berthold von Henneberg, Archbishop of Mainz.

[1] He served as Auxiliary Bishop of Mainz until his death on 8 Aug 1510.

[1] While bishop, he was the principal consecrator of Jakob von Liebenstein, Archbishop of Mainz (1505).
